Part Overview

The SN74HC00PWT is a 4-channel 2-input NAND gate logic IC manufactured by Texas Instruments in a 14-TSSOP surface mount package. This part is discontinued at DiGi Electronics, making equivalent substitutes necessary for ongoing production and maintenance applications. The SN74HC00PWT operates across a 2V to 6V supply voltage range with low quiescent current and standard propagation delay characteristics suitable for general-purpose digital logic applications.

Key Parameters

Parameter Value
Logic Type NAND Gate
Number of Circuits 4
Number of Inputs 2
Voltage - Supply 2V ~ 6V
Current - Quiescent (Max) 2 µA
Current - Output High, Low 5.2mA, 5.2mA
Input Logic Level - Low 0.5V ~ 1.8V
Input Logic Level - High 1.5V ~ 4.2V
Max Propagation Delay @ 6V, 50pF 15ns
Operating Temperature -40°C ~ 85°C
Package / Case 14-TSSOP (0.173", 4.40mm Width)
Mounting Type Surface Mount
RoHS Status ROHS3 Compliant
Moisture Sensitivity Level (MSL) 1 (Unlimited)

Substitute Part Grouping Explanation

Substitution of the SN74HC00PWT is determined by strict equivalence across the following critical parameters:

  • Logic function: 4-channel 2-input NAND gate
  • Package type: 14-TSSOP surface mount
  • Supply voltage range: 2V ~ 6V minimum
  • Output current capability: 5.2mA minimum for both high and low states
  • Input logic thresholds: 0.5V ~ 1.8V (low), 1.5V ~ 4.2V (high)
  • Propagation delay: 15ns maximum at 6V, 50pF load
  • Operating temperature: -40°C minimum to 85°C minimum
  • RoHS3 compliance and MSL Level 1 rating

Substitute parts are grouped by manufacturer and packaging configuration. All listed substitutes maintain identical logic function, package footprint, and core electrical specifications. Variations in quiescent current, maximum propagation delay, and operating temperature range are noted where they exceed the original specification, indicating enhanced or equivalent performance.

Engineering Selection Recommendations

SN74HC00PWR (Texas Instruments) — Recommended primary substitute. Active product status with identical electrical specifications to the discontinued SN74HC00PWT. Maintains the same supply voltage range, quiescent current, output drive capability, and propagation delay. Available in both Cut Tape and Digi-Reel packaging options. ROHS3 compliant with MSL Level 1 rating.

MC74HC00ADTR2G (onsemi) — Direct manufacturer alternative with enhanced performance characteristics. Quiescent current reduced to 1 µA and propagation delay improved to 13ns at 6V, 50pF. Extended operating temperature range of -55°C to 125°C provides margin beyond the original specification. Supplied in Tape & Reel packaging. ROHS3 compliant with MSL Level 1 rating.

74HC00T14-13 (Diodes Incorporated) — MFR-recommended substitute with active product status. Maintains core electrical specifications with extended upper operating temperature limit of 125°C. Quiescent current specification of 20 µA is higher than the original part but remains within acceptable limits for general-purpose logic applications. Supplied in Tape & Reel packaging. ROHS3 compliant with MSL Level 1 rating.

MM74HC00MTCX (Fairchild Semiconductor) — Parametric equivalent with active product status. Electrical specifications match the original SN74HC00PWT across all critical parameters. Operating temperature range identical to the original part at -40°C to 85°C. Packaging configuration not specified in available documentation.

Frequently Asked Questions (FAQ)

Q: Can I directly replace SN74HC00PWT with SN74HC00PWR in my circuit?

A: Yes. Both parts are Texas Instruments 74HC00 NAND gate ICs in 14-TSSOP packages with identical electrical specifications. The SN74HC00PWR is the active production equivalent of the discontinued SN74HC00PWT.

Q: What is the difference between the onsemi MC74HC00ADTR2G and the original SN74HC00PWT?

A: The MC74HC00ADTR2G offers improved performance with lower quiescent current (1 µA vs. 2 µA) and faster propagation delay (13ns vs. 15ns). It also supports an extended operating temperature range of -55°C to 125°C compared to -40°C to 85°C. All other electrical parameters remain equivalent.

Q: Are all substitute parts in the same package?

A: Yes. All listed substitutes use the 14-TSSOP surface mount package with identical footprint dimensions of 0.173" width and 4.40mm overall width. PCB layout and reflow soldering parameters remain unchanged.

Q: Does the higher quiescent current of the 74HC00T14-13 affect circuit performance?

A: The 74HC00T14-13 specifies a maximum quiescent current of 20 µA compared to 2 µA for the original part. This represents a worst-case specification and does not affect logic function or output drive capability. For battery-powered or ultra-low-power applications, the lower quiescent current alternatives (SN74HC00PWR, MC74HC00ADTR2G, or MM74HC00MTCX) are preferred.

Q: Are all substitutes RoHS3 compliant?

A: SN74HC00PWR, MC74HC00ADTR2G, and 74HC00T14-13 are confirmed ROHS3 compliant with MSL Level 1 ratings. Fairchild MM74HC00MTCX compliance status is not specified in available documentation.

Q: What packaging options are available for production quantities?

A: SN74HC00PWR is available in both Cut Tape and Digi-Reel packaging. MC74HC00ADTR2G and 74HC00T14-13 are supplied in Tape & Reel format for automated assembly. Packaging selection depends on production volume and assembly equipment compatibility.
